Analysis

Bolivia (Plurinational State of) recorded 1,373 kt for on-farm energy use — emissions (co2eq) in 2023. That is the highest value across all 34 years on record.

Compared with earlier readings it is up 38.9% over ten years.

Over the whole period, on-farm energy use — emissions (co2eq) in Bolivia (Plurinational State of) peaked at 1,373 kt in 2022 and was at its lowest, 24.1 kt, in 1997.

The series is highly variable year to year, so single readings are best treated with caution.

On-farm energy use — Emissions (CO2eq) in Bolivia (Plurinational State of), year by year

Annual values for On-farm energy use — Emissions (CO2eq) (AR5) in Bolivia (Plurinational State of), 1990 to 2023.
Year kt Change
1990 63.3 kt
1991 123.09 kt +94.5%
1992 118.55 kt -3.7%
1993 39.66 kt -66.5%
1994 41.67 kt +5.1%
1995 45.21 kt +8.5%
1996 27.61 kt -38.9%
1997 24.1 kt -12.7%
1998 24.1 kt +0.0%
1999 27.09 kt +12.4%
2000 973.27 kt +3492.7%
2001 918.29 kt -5.6%
2002 891.43 kt -2.9%
2003 918 kt +3.0%
2004 910.38 kt -0.8%
2005 903.93 kt -0.7%
2006 954.59 kt +5.6%
2007 1,008 kt +5.6%
2008 1,051 kt +4.3%
2009 1,026 kt -2.3%
2010 1,064 kt +3.7%
2011 1,030 kt -3.2%
2012 1,015 kt -1.4%
2013 988.76 kt -2.6%
2014 973.03 kt -1.6%
2015 931.27 kt -4.3%
2016 890.87 kt -4.3%
2017 873.5 kt -2.0%
2018 1,034 kt +18.3%
2019 1,113 kt +7.7%
2020 913.3 kt -17.9%
2021 1,205 kt +31.9%
2022 1,373 kt +14.0%
2023 1,373 kt +0.0%

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ness. Methodological details can be found at: https://files-faostat.fao.org/production/GT/GT_en.pdf
